D “Photo Flicker Reduction”
Flicker r
eduction may slightly delay shutter response.
Flicker reduction can detect flicker at 100 and 120Hz (associated respectively with AC power
supplies of 50 and 60Hz). The desired results may not be achieved if the frequency of the power
supply changes during burst photography.
Flicker may not be detected or the desired results may not be achieved depending on the light
source and shooting conditions, for example with scenes that are brightly lit or feature dark
backgrounds.
The desired results may also not be achieved with decorative lighting displays and other non-
standard lighting.
The actual effects of photo flicker reduction may differ from those visible in the display.

D “Photo Flicker Reduction”: Restrictions
[Photo flicker reduction] does not take effect under some conditions, including:
during HDR overlay,
during high-speed frame capture +, and
in silent mode.
